timbag
N-, pa-, ma-
-an
-an, -un, pa--un
To throw s.t. downwards (as a toy top); to throw s.t. down (at s.t. or s.o. very close by).
The -an imp. focuses on the object being thrown. The -un imp. focuses on the thing or person being thrown at. The pa--un imp. focuses on both the object and goal of the object and can be used interchangeably with -an imp. when the goal is specified.
Ongoy bay timbagan nu ket-kehet nu?
Why did you throw down your saw?
Ongoy bay patimbag nu galon nu ta' batu?
Why did you throw your container on the rock?
(Figurative languge for) to be after what someone else has. (Seldom used with actor focus.)
Ilooy tinimbag me' na alta' nu, sangkon na nabangan kau.
That which he is after is your belongings, that's why he is helping you.
